Can A Mug Crack From Hot Water?

Yes, mugs and other ceramics can crack from hot water. The temperature difference between the hot water and the mug can cause thermal shock, which creates stress in the mug and eventually leads to a crack.

Ceramic mugs may crack due to thermal shock. This occurs when a vessel made of one material is rapidly heated and then cooled. If the temperature change is too great, the ceramic mug may crack.
